ARTICHOKE AND FENNEL CRUDO

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     side-dish

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7



Artichoke and Fennel Crudo image

Steps:

  • Whisk together the olive oil and lemon juice in a small bowl. In a separate medium bowl, place the arugula. Spoon a small amount of the dressing onto the arugula and toss to coat. Spread a bed of arugula on a plate and set aside.
  • In a large bowl, combine the sliced artichokes, fennel,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per with the remaining dressing. Mix well to coat. Mound the artichoke mixture on top of the arugula. Top with the shaved Parmesan and serve.

2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 1/2 tablespoons lemon juice (1 large lemon)
1 1/2 cups baby arugula
5 baby artichokes, trimmed and thinly sliced
1 bulb fennel, thinly sliced
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up shaved Parmesan

ARTICHOKE, FENNEL, AND EDAMAME SALAD

Categories     Salad     Soy     Roast     Vegetarian     Lemon     Artichoke     Fennel     Summer     Vegan     Shallot     Parsley     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es 16 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Artichoke, Fennel, and Edamame Salad image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°F. Fill medium bowl with cold water. Add 2 tablespoons lemon juice. Working with 1 artichoke at a time, pull off tough outer leaves (about 3 rows). Cut tip and stem off artichoke. Cut artichoke in half. Scoop out any choke. Place in lemon water.
  • Spray large rimmed baking sheet with nonstick spray. Drain artichokes; pat dry. Return to bowl. Add 3 tablespoons oil and toss. Transfer to prepared sheet; sprinkle with salt and pepper. Roast until tender when pierced, stirring once, about 20 minutes. Cool on sheet.
  • Whisk 6 tablespoons lemon juice, 1/2 cup oil, shallots, fennel seeds, and lemon peel in large bowl. Stir in sliced fennel, parsley, artichokes, and edamame. Season with salt and pepper. (Can be made 1 day ahead. Cover and chill.) Garnish with reserved fennel fronds and serve.
  • *Edamame (soybeans) are available at many supermarkets.

8 tablespoons fresh lemon juice, divided
3 pounds baby artichokes
Nonstick vegetable oil spray
3 tablespoons plus 1/2 cup olive oil
1/4 cup chopped shallots
1 teaspoon fennel seeds
1 teaspoon grated lemon peel
3 medium fennel bulbs, trimmed (fronds reserved), quartered, thinly sliced crosswise (about 4 cups)
1/2 cup chopped fresh Italian parsley
4 1/2 cups cooked shelled edamame*

SHAVED FENNEL, ARTICHOKE, AND PARMESAN SALAD

Provided by Alice Waters

Categories     Salad     No-Cook     Vegetarian     Parmesan     Lemon     Artichoke     Fennel     Parsley

Yield Serves 6

Number Of Ingredients 8



Shaved Fennel, Artichoke, and Parmesan Salad image

Steps:

  • Pare the artichokes down to their hearts and scoop out the chokes with a spoon, dropping them into water acidulated with the juice of 1 of the lemons.
  • Cut off the feathery tops of the fennel at the base of their stalks and remove the outer layer of the bulbs. Slice the bulbs very thin with a mandolin or a very sharp knife. Remove the artichoke hearts from the water and slice them very thin the same way.
  • Assemble the salad in layers on a large platter or on individual salad plates. First make a layer of the fennel slices. Squeeze lemon juice evenly over the fennel and drizzle with salt and pepper. Then make a layer of the artichoke hearts, also slice very thin. Squeeze more lemon juice over them, drizzle evenly with another third of the oils, and season with salt and pepper. Cut thin shavings of the Parmesan with cheese slicer or a vegetable peeler and arrange them on top of the artichoke slices. Scatter the parsley leaves over the cheese, season with salt and pepper, squeeze more lemon juice over, and drizzle evenly with the rest of the oils. Serve immediately.

2 large artichokes
2 lemons
2 large fennel bulbs
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 to 2 tablespoons white truffle oil
salt and pepper
1 piece Reggiano Parmesan cheese (about 3 ounces)
About 1/2 cup Italian parsley leaves

FRITO MISTO OF ARTICHOKES AND FENNEL

Provided by Amanda Hesser

Categories     project, appetizer

Time 50m

Yield 4 appetizer servings

Number Of Ingredients 12



Frito Misto Of Artichokes And Fennel image

Steps:

  • Fill a large bowl with water, and add lemon juice. Peel away outer leaves of artichokes, leaving tender pale green leaves. Peel stems, and cut off spiny tops of leaves. Cut lengthwise into quarters. Immediately add artichokes to water.
  • Slice fennel bulb in half through the root. Slice each half crosswise, about 1/4 inch thick. Slices should be half-moon shapes. Place fennel in a medium bowl, and set aside. In a small bowl, combine cheese, garlic and parsley. Toss gently to mix.
  • In a large deep pan, heat oil over medium-low heat to 275 degrees. Drain artichokes, and dry completely with a dish towel. Add artichokes to oil, and cook until they begin to open and brown. Remove from pan, and let drain on paper towels.
  • Raise heat to medium-high or 350 degrees. Pour milk over fennel, and place flour in a medium bowl. Strain fennel, then toss lightly in flour to coat. Drop fennel and artichokes into oil, and fry until golden brown and crispy. Using a strainer, remove from oil and place on a plate lined with paper towels. Let drain for 30 seconds, then transfer to a large bowl. Sprinkle parsley mixture and a little olive oil over artichoke mixture. Season with salt. Toss briefly to combine ingredients. Transfer to a serving bowl or platter, with lemon wedges.

Juice of 1 lemon
12 small artichokes
1 bulb fennel, trimmed
1/4 cup thinly shaved Parmesan cheese
1 clove garlic, crushed and finely chopped
2 tablespoons finely chopped flat-leaf parsley
2 quarts vegetable or canola oil
1 cup milk
1/2 cup flour
Olive oil, for sprinkling
1 lemon, cut into quarters
Kosher salt, to taste

ARTICHOKE, FENNEL, AND CRISPY PROSCIUTTO SALAD

Categories     Salad     Citrus     Leafy Green     Herb     Mustard     Onion     Appetizer     Sauté     Quick & Easy     Low Cal     High Fiber     Lunch     Artichoke     Fennel     Prosciutto     Bon Appétit     Paleo     Dairy Free     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11



Artichoke, Fennel, and Crispy Prosciutto Salad image

Steps:

  • Whisk 3 tablespoons olive oil and next 5 ingredients in small bowl. Season dressing to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Heat remaining 1 tablespoon oil in nonstick medium skillet over medium-high heat. Add prosciutto and sauté until crisp, about 4 minutes. Transfer prosciutto to paper towels to drain.
  • Fill medium bowl with cold water. Squeeze juice from lemon halves into water; add lemon halves. Cut off stem from 1 artichoke, then bend back all outer leaves and snap off where leaves break naturally (only small cone of pale green inner leaves will remain). Trim off all dark green parts. Cut out and discard choke. Slice artichoke bottom very thinly. Place in lemon water. Repeat with remaining 3 artichokes. Do ahead Dressing, prosciutto, and artichokes can be made 2 hours ahead. Let stand at room temperature.
  • Drain artichokes well; transfer to large bowl. Add 2 tablespoons lemon juice and sliced fennel; toss. Mix in frisée and dressing; toss. Season salad with salt and pepper. Sprinkle with prosciutto and chopped fennel fronds.

4 tablespoons olive oil, divided
2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1 small shallot, finely chopped
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on chopped fresh thyme
6 ounces thinly sliced prosciutto, cut crosswise into 1/3-inch-wide strips (about 1 1/2 cups)
1 lemon, halved, plus 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
4 large artichokes
1 large fennel bulb with fronds, bulb halved lengthwise and very thinly sliced crosswise, fronds chopped
2 medium heads of frisée, torn into bite-size pieces

ROASTED FENNEL AND ARTICHOKE HEARTS

Canned artichokes add subtlety and flavor to this meal. We like the Whole Foods 365 brand because the artichokes don't come out too salty when roasted.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Healthy Recipes     Gluten-Free Recipes

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 6



Roasted Fennel and Artichoke Hearts image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Arrange fennel and artichokes on a rimmed baking sheet. Drizzle with 2 tablespoons oil, and season with salt and pepper. Roast vegetables until caramelized on both sides, about 35 minutes, tossing after 20 minutes.
  • Drizzle with remaining oil and the lemon juice. Add parsley, and toss to combine. Garnish with fennel fronds.

1 fennel bulb (12 ounces), cut into 3/4-inch wedges, 1 tablespoon fronds reserved for garnish
1 can whole artichoke hearts in water (13.75 ounces), drained, patted dry, and cut in half lengthwise
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Coarse sal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
2 tablespoons roughly chopped flat-leaf parsley
